Internet Archive
The Internet Archive hosts a huge Live Music Archive collection with many Grateful Dead recordings and metadata. Deadhead High links out to Archive items when a show has a listening source.
Relisten
Relisten gives fans a clean way to browse and play many Archive-hosted recordings by date. It is often the fastest way to jump from a show recommendation into listening.
Official releases
Official releases, box sets, and subscription services can offer polished mastering and curated packages. Deadhead High is aimed at discovery, then sends you to the source that makes sense.

Can I listen to Grateful Dead shows for free?
Many audience and soundboard recordings are available through the Internet Archive and Relisten. Official commercial releases are separate.
What is the difference between Archive and Relisten?
Archive hosts recordings and metadata; Relisten offers a streamlined fan-facing way to browse and play many of those recordings.
